Principle and features of 3D ultrasonic inspection system Matrixeye™ (synthetic aperture method)
A wide beam transmitted by electronic scanning is received with full aperture, allowing for transmission and reception of ultrasound through numerous channels. The large amount of ultrasound data received creates a 3D image with the following features.
- The entire depth of the inspection object is evenly focused.
(The resolution is reduced outside focused areas in monocular probes and phased-array probes). - Overlapping many ultrasonic waveforms improves signal-to-noise ratio.
